Author:John Matthews Manly

John Matthews Manly
(1865–1940)
A.M., Ph.D. Professor and Head of the Department of English in the University of Chicago. Managing Editor of Modern Philology. Author of The Language of Chaucer's Legend of Good Women; &c. Editor of Specimens of the Pre-Shakespearian Drama; English Prose, 1137-1890; English Poetry, 1170-1892; &c.

This author wrote articles for the 1911 Encyclopædia Britannica
Articles written by this author are designated in the EB1911 by the initials "J. M. Ma."
